From 7b9823dad19831110549d312654b900aefdc355a Mon Sep 17 00:00:00 2001 From: Nathan Klick Date: Thu, 3 Aug 2023 17:10:51 -0500 Subject: [PATCH] chore: remove workarounds previously implemented Signed-off-by: Nathan Klick --- dev/scripts/direct-install.sh | 2 -- dev/scripts/helper.sh | 18 ------------------ docker/ubi8-init-java17/Dockerfile | 3 --- docker/ubi8-init-java17/network-node.service | 3 +-- 4 files changed, 1 insertion(+), 25 deletions(-) diff --git a/dev/scripts/direct-install.sh b/dev/scripts/direct-install.sh index 575b30bcb..c31f7f2d1 100644 --- a/dev/scripts/direct-install.sh +++ b/dev/scripts/direct-install.sh @@ -68,8 +68,6 @@ function setup_node_all() { ls_path "${pod}" "${HAPI_PATH}/data/keys/" set_permission "${pod}" "${HAPI_PATH}" - # TODO remove set_application_env after 0.5.0 docker image is published - set_application_env "${pod}" unzip_build "${pod}" done } diff --git a/dev/scripts/helper.sh b/dev/scripts/helper.sh index 5bb421198..03fb6577b 100755 --- a/dev/scripts/helper.sh +++ b/dev/scripts/helper.sh @@ -735,21 +735,3 @@ function reset_node_all() { return "${EX_OK}" } - -# TODO remove set_application_env after 0.5.0 docker image is published -function set_application_env() { - local pod="${1}" - - echo "" - echo "Populating values in /etc/network-node/application.env ${pod}" - echo "-----------------------------------------------------------------------------------------------------" - - if [ -z "${pod}" ]; then - echo "ERROR: 'reset_nmt' - pod name is required" - return "${EX_ERR}" - fi - - # best effort clean up of docker env - "${KCTL}" exec "${pod}" -c root-container -- bash -c "echo APP_HOME=/opt/hgcapp/services-hedera/HapiApp2.0 > /etc/network-node/application.env" || true - return "${EX_OK}" -} diff --git a/docker/ubi8-init-java17/Dockerfile b/docker/ubi8-init-java17/Dockerfile index a0023d148..436a71ffd 100644 --- a/docker/ubi8-init-java17/Dockerfile +++ b/docker/ubi8-init-java17/Dockerfile @@ -107,9 +107,6 @@ RUN chmod -R +x /etc/network-node/entrypoint.sh && \ RUN mkdir -p /etc/network-node && \ touch /etc/network-node/application.env && \ - echo "APP_HOME=/opt/hgcapp/services-hedera/HapiApp2.0" >> /etc/network-node/application.env && \ - echo "JAVA_HOME=\"${JAVA_HOME}\"" >> /etc/network-node/java.env && \ - echo "PATH=\"${PATH}\"" >> /etc/network-node/java.env && \ chown -R 2000:2000 /etc/network-node # Expose TCP/UDP Port Definitions diff --git a/docker/ubi8-init-java17/network-node.service b/docker/ubi8-init-java17/network-node.service index 8d6a46eb2..634d70aa9 100644 --- a/docker/ubi8-init-java17/network-node.service +++ b/docker/ubi8-init-java17/network-node.service @@ -8,8 +8,7 @@ Restart=no User=hedera Group=hedera -PassEnvironment=JAVA_HOME PATH APP_HOME -EnvironmentFile=/etc/network-node/java.env +PassEnvironment=JAVA_HOME JAVA_OPTS JAVA_HEAP_MIN JAVA_HEAP_MAX PATH APP_HOME EnvironmentFile=/etc/network-node/application.env WorkingDirectory=/opt/hgcapp/services-hedera/HapiApp2.0